Information on College Selection and Application
In 2024 and 2025, GT Advocates from Adams 12 high schools hosted college planning nights where they presented an overview of the college search and planning process along with breakout sessions on such topics as how to pay for college; how to complete the Common Application; how to write a strong college entrance essay; how to make college "feel smaller"; and how to navigate the athletic recruiting and the fine arts audition-process. Below you can find slide decks from those presentations as well as some additional shared resources. Please not that this information was put together in 2024-2025. While most of the content is broadly relevant, some references (such as Naviance instead of Schoolinks) may be outdated.
